烟沙科普>科技知识>提升云存储效率:关键性能优化策略揭秘

提升云存储效率:关键性能优化策略揭秘

时间:2025-02-17 来源:烟沙科普

在当今信息化飞速发展的时代,云存储已经成为个人和企业存储数据的主要方式之一。随着数据量的爆炸式增长,如何提升云存储的效率成为了一项关键课题。本文将详细探讨提升云存储效率的关键性能优化策略,帮助读者更好地理解和应用这些技术。

一、理解云存储的核心挑战

在深入探讨优化策略之前,首先需要理解云存储面临的核心挑战。云存储系统需要在性能、可扩展性、可靠性和成本之间找到平衡。随着用户和数据量的增加,存储系统的响应时间可能变长,数据传输速度可能下降,这些问题都会直接影响用户体验和业务效率。因此,提升云存储效率不仅是技术需求,更是业务发展的必要条件。

二、数据去重与压缩技术

数据去重和压缩是提升云存储效率的两大关键技术。数据去重技术通过消除冗余数据块,减少存储空间的使用。例如,在多个用户上传相同的文件时,系统只需存储一份文件,并为每个用户创建引用。这不仅节省了空间,还加快了数据检索的速度。

数据压缩技术则通过算法将数据转换为更小的尺寸。常用的压缩算法包括ZIP、GZIP等,这些算法在保证数据完整性的前提下,大幅减少了存储需求。需要注意的是,选择合适的压缩算法和策略至关重要,因为过度压缩可能导致解压时消耗更多的计算资源。

三、缓存与分层存储

缓存技术通过将频繁访问的数据存储在高速存储介质中,如内存或固态硬盘,从而提高数据访问速度。在云存储系统中,缓存可以应用于客户端、服务器端以及中间代理服务器,以减少数据传输的延迟。

分层存储则是根据数据的访问频率和重要性,将数据存储在不同性能的存储介质上。例如,热数据可以存储在高性能的固态硬盘中,而冷数据则可以迁移到低成本的机械硬盘或磁带中。这种策略不仅提高了访问效率,还降低了存储成本。

四、负载均衡与分布式存储

负载均衡技术通过将用户请求合理分配到多个服务器上,避免单个服务器过载,从而提高系统的整体性能和可靠性。在云存储环境中,负载均衡可以动态调整资源分配,保证在高并发情况下仍能提供高效的服务。

分布式存储系统通过将数据分散存储在多个物理节点上,提高了系统的可扩展性和容错能力。例如,Hadoop分布式文件系统(HDFS)和Ceph等技术,能够在大规模集群中实现高效的数据存储和管理。分布式存储不仅提升了存储容量,还通过并行处理提高了数据访问速度。

五、智能数据管理与自动化

智能数据管理技术通过分析用户行为和数据特征,自动优化数据存储和管理策略。例如,机器学习算法可以预测用户访问模式,提前将热数据缓存到高速存储介质中,减少访问延迟。

自动化工具则可以帮助管理员更高效地管理和维护存储系统。例如,自动化备份和恢复工具可以定期备份数据,并在数据丢失或损坏时快速恢复,减少人工操作的错误和延迟。

六、安全与隐私保护

在提升云存储效率的同时,安全与隐私保护同样不容忽视。数据加密技术可以保护数据在传输和存储过程中的安全,防止数据被未经授权的用户访问。访问控制策略则可以限制不同用户对数据的访问权限,确保数据只被授权用户访问。

此外,隐私保护技术如数据匿名化和差分隐私,可以在不影响数据分析的前提下,保护用户的隐私信息。这些技术的应用不仅提升了数据的安全性,还增强了用户对云存储服务的信任。

七、未来发展趋势

随着技术的不断进步,云存储效率的提升仍有许多潜力可挖。例如,量子存储技术、边缘计算和人工智能的结合,可能会带来存储性能的革命性突破。量子存储技术能够大幅提高数据存储密度和访问速度,而边缘计算则通过将计算和存储资源下沉到网络边缘,减少了数据传输的延迟。

同时,人工智能技术的应用,可以通过智能预测和优化,进一步提升云存储的效率和管理水平。例如,AI算法可以自动调整缓存策略和负载均衡策略,根据实时数据流量动态优化系统性能。

结语

提升云存储效率是一个复杂而多面的课题,涉及技术、管理和安全等多个方面。通过数据去重与压缩、缓存与分层存储、负载均衡与分布式存储、智能数据管理与自动化、以及安全与隐私保护等策略,可以显著提高云存储的性能和可靠性。随着技术的不断

CopyRight © 2024 烟沙科普 | 豫ICP备2021025408号-1